Memory-safe sudo to become the default in Ubuntu

MeetUbuntu 25.10’s new sidekick:sudo-rs. This Rust-powered, memory-safe twist on sudo amps up security and simplifies upkeep. It embraces the mantra "less is more" by tossing unnecessary sudo features overboard. Canonical’s strategy—security without the bloat—aims for the long game... read more

Speeding up Terraform caching with OverlayFS

Terraform's plugin cache chokes when confronted withconcurrent runs. Picture a traffic jam at rush hour—it ain't pretty. EnterOverlayFS, the urban planner for your code. It tricks each simultaneous Terraform init into believing it's hogging the same plugin cache. Then, with finesse, it syncs everyth.. read more
